The case for vaccinating children under 12 against COVID-19 – News-Medical.Net
Researchers assess the need for co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) vaccination in children who are 12 years of age or younger….

In a recent study published on the preprint server medRxiv*, researchers assess the need for co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) vaccination in children who are 12 years of age or younger. To this end, the researchers compared the clinical characteristics…
